Measurements Using Capacitive Sensors

Precise Measurements Using Capacitive Sensors Capacitive sensors can be divided into two categories based upon their performance and intended use. High resolution sensors are typically used in displacement and position monitoring applications where high accuracy, stability and low temperature drift are required. Quite frequently these sensors are used in process monitoring and closed-loop feedback control systems. Proximity type capacitive sensors are much less expensive and are typically used to detect the presence of a part or used in counting applications. Engine Vibration and Balancing Principles

What do you think when you’re flying home, cruising at 30,000 feet and the drinks have just been served? Our engineers think about the ripple in the glass. That ripple signals vibration and is an indication that the engine may be in need of a balance. The MTII’s PBS-4100+ Series Turbine Vibration Analyzer/Balancing System was developed to ensure that Turbine engines run as efficiently as possible.
